如何解决使用IDEA启动项目时遇到的ClassNotFoundException问题?

2026-05-26 04:260阅读0评论SEO资源
  • 内容介绍
  • 文章标签
  • 相关推荐

本文共计1380个文字,预计阅读时间需要6分钟。

如何解决使用IDEA启动项目时遇到的ClassNotFoundException问题?

一. 错误现象:本地开发SpringBoot项目时,集成MyBatis查询数据库时,使用IDEA启动项目,偶尔会出现以下错误:

Caused by: java.sql.SQLException: com.mysql.jdbc.Driver

二. 可能原因及解决方案:

1. 原因:MySQL JDBC驱动未正确配置。 解决方案:确保在项目的`pom.xml`中正确添加了MySQL JDBC依赖。

2. 原因:IDEA的数据库连接配置不正确。 解决方案:检查IDEA中数据库连接的URL、用户名、密码是否正确。

3. 原因:MySQL JDBC驱动版本不兼容。 解决方案:检查项目中使用的MySQL JDBC驱动版本与MySQL服务器版本是否兼容,必要时更新驱动版本。

4. 原因:项目中的数据库配置文件(如`application.properties`或`application.yml`)配置错误。 解决方案:检查配置文件中的数据库连接参数是否正确。

5. 原因:数据库连接池配置不正确。 解决方案:检查数据库连接池的配置,如HikariCP、Druid等,确保配置正确。

三. 验证解决方案:

1. 验证JDBC依赖是否正确添加到`pom.xml`。

2.检查IDEA数据库连接配置。

3.更新MySQL JDBC驱动版本。

4.重新配置数据库连接参数。

5.检查数据库连接池配置。

阅读全文

本文共计1380个文字,预计阅读时间需要6分钟。

如何解决使用IDEA启动项目时遇到的ClassNotFoundException问题?

一. 错误现象:本地开发SpringBoot项目时,集成MyBatis查询数据库时,使用IDEA启动项目,偶尔会出现以下错误:

Caused by: java.sql.SQLException: com.mysql.jdbc.Driver

二. 可能原因及解决方案:

1. 原因:MySQL JDBC驱动未正确配置。 解决方案:确保在项目的`pom.xml`中正确添加了MySQL JDBC依赖。

2. 原因:IDEA的数据库连接配置不正确。 解决方案:检查IDEA中数据库连接的URL、用户名、密码是否正确。

3. 原因:MySQL JDBC驱动版本不兼容。 解决方案:检查项目中使用的MySQL JDBC驱动版本与MySQL服务器版本是否兼容,必要时更新驱动版本。

4. 原因:项目中的数据库配置文件(如`application.properties`或`application.yml`)配置错误。 解决方案:检查配置文件中的数据库连接参数是否正确。

5. 原因:数据库连接池配置不正确。 解决方案:检查数据库连接池的配置,如HikariCP、Druid等,确保配置正确。

三. 验证解决方案:

1. 验证JDBC依赖是否正确添加到`pom.xml`。

2.检查IDEA数据库连接配置。

3.更新MySQL JDBC驱动版本。

4.重新配置数据库连接参数。

5.检查数据库连接池配置。

阅读全文